I have a B&M.... first thing i can say is replace the bushing it comes with, with an OEM one $3.. it'll reduce the play that the s***ty B&M bushing has and if you dont replace it the shifter will make a crazy vibration sound at high rpms. If you arent deliberate with the shifts you can miss 3rd, I guess the best way to describe is it feels notchy. I do like it tho. It feels solid if im ripping gears tho.
i did have an issue with fluid building up on top of the shifter but it might have been from the vent tube that is on top of the transmission, i ended up putting a rubber hose on the vent and never checked for fluid build up again lol..
